All errors (new ones prefixed by >>):

   fs/erofs/inode.c: In function 'erofs_read_inode':
>> fs/erofs/inode.c:55:3: error: a label can only be part of a statement and a 
>> declaration is not a statement
      55 |   struct erofs_inode_extended *die, *copied = NULL;
         |   ^~~~~~
